shopirun
A simple CLI tool to streamline Shopify theme development and deployment workflows.
Features
- 🚀 Start Development Server – Launch local development server with hot-reload and theme editor sync
- 📦 Smart Deployment – Deploy all files or specific file types with backup options
- 📥 Selective File Pulling – Pull all theme files or target specific file types (JSON, locales, templates)
- 🎯 Interactive Menu System – User-friendly interface with organized principal and secondary commands
- ⚙️ Configuration Support – Store settings and theme configurations in
shopirun.config.json - 🎨 Theme Management – Create new unpublished themes and manage multiple theme environments
- 💾 Automatic Backups – Create timestamped backups before major deployments
- 📋 Direct Command Execution – Run commands directly from terminal or through interactive menu
Installation
Install globally via npm:
npm install -g shopirunUsage
Run the CLI and select a command from the interactive menu:
shopirunOr run a command directly. For Example:
shopirun start
shopirun deploy-all
shopirun pull-jsons
shopirun make-backup-and-deploy-allBackup Feature
Commands with make-backup-and- prefix automatically create a timestamped backup of the selected theme before making changes. Backup themes are named with the format: [Backup DD/MM] | Shopirun
Principal Commands
start– Start local development server with hot-reload and theme editor syncpull-all– Pull all theme files from the storepull-jsons– Pull only JSON files (templates, config, locales) without deleting existing filesmake-backup-and-deploy-all– Create a timestamped backup and deploy all theme filesdeploy-all– Deploy all theme files to the selected thememake-backup-and-deploy-without-jsons– Create backup and deploy excluding JSON filesdeploy-without-jsons– Deploy theme files excluding JSON configuration files
Secondary Commands (via "Other" menu)
pull-locales– Pull only translation/locale filespull-templates– Pull only template JSON filespull-config– Pull only settings_data.json configurationdeploy-locales– Deploy only locale/translation filesdeploy-templates– Deploy only template JSON filesdeploy-config– Deploy only settings_data.jsondeploy-jsons– Deploy all JSON files (templates, config, locales)deploy-new– Create and deploy as new unpublished theme
Configuration
Create a shopirun.config.json file in your project root to streamline your workflow:
{
"store": "your-store.myshopify.com",
"themes": {
"staging": 123456789,
"live": 987654321
}
}Configuration Options
store(string): Your Shopify store URL (automatically formats to .myshopify.com)themes(object, optional): Map custom theme names to their IDs for quick selection
Benefits
- ✅ Skip store URL input on every command
- ✅ Quick theme selection by name instead of entering IDs
- ✅ Support for multiple environments (dev, staging, production)
- ✅ Automatic error handling for missing or invalid configuration
If no configuration file is found, the CLI will prompt for required information and show a helpful reminder about creating the config file.
Requirements
- Node.js >= 14
- Shopify CLI v3.x (automatically installed via
@shopify/clidependency) - Access to a Shopify store and theme development permissions
How It Works
Shopirun is a wrapper around the official Shopify CLI that provides:
- Simplified command structure with intuitive naming
- Interactive prompts for theme and store selection
- Automatic backup creation before destructive operations
- Organized menu system separating principal and secondary commands
- Smart parameter handling and validation
Troubleshooting
Common Issues
- "Command not found": Ensure shopirun is installed globally with
-gflag - Configuration errors: Check that your
shopirun.config.jsonhas valid JSON syntax - Theme ID errors: Verify theme IDs are numbers, not strings in the config file
- Store access: Ensure you're logged into Shopify CLI (
shopify auth login)
